The contact owns a 1999 Mercury Grand Marquis. The contact stated that while changing a flat tire with the factory jack, the jack bent and caused the vehicle to fall off the jack. The contact was able to change the tire and then called the manufacture. The manufacturer stated that the vehicle was outside of warranty so there was nothing they could do to assist. The jack was not replaced. The failure mileage was 81,000.

Vehicle's passenger side front tire blew out and while changing the tire the jack collapsed. The jack the consumer was new since this was the first time the vehicle ever had a flat tire. The consumer took the jack to the local dealer who offered to order a new one which would have to be paid for. The consumer refused the offer especially since the replacement was the same as the one that collapsed. The consumer believes the jack is not sufficient to raise the vehicle.
The right front tire experienced a blowout while driving on a 2 lane back road at 30 mph. Also, the jack broke in half when vehicle was being jacked up to remove the blowout tire. This caused the vehicle to crash down and almost sever the consumer's leg. Manufacturer was notified, and requested that the consumer send the jack to there corporate office.
